May 6, 2026 ETH Technical Analysis
1. Core Price and Trend
Currently ETH quotes at $2,380, up 1.05% intraday, moving in tandem with BTC's strong upward trend, showing a linked rebound and a slightly bullish oscillation structure; the trend is weaker than BTC, consolidating at high levels, with stable buying support, and no signs of volume-driven pullbacks.
2. Key Support/Resistance Levels
Support Levels
• First Support: $2,360 (intraday pullback stabilization level, short-term bullish defense line)
• Core Support: $2,330–$2,340 (4-hour moving average support, the dividing line between bulls and bears)
• Strong Support: $2,300 (trend structure support, breaking below invalidates short-term bullish logic)
Resistance Levels
• First Resistance: $2,400 (short-term psychological barrier + previous trapped positions pressure)
• Core Resistance: $2,420–$2,450 (Bollinger Band upper band pressure zone, breaking through opens upward space)
• Strong Resistance: $2,500 (key target for medium-term rebound)
3. Technical Indicator Analysis
1. Moving Average System: Price above the 5-day/20-day moving averages, facing resistance at the 50-day moving average, short-term moving averages turning upward, medium- and long-term moving averages maintaining a bullish arrangement, trend leaning bullish.
2. RSI Indicator: Positioned in the neutral to slightly strong zone at 60–62, approaching overbought threshold, bullish momentum sufficient, no divergence signals.
3. MACD Indicator: Continuing with red bars above zero line, fast and slow lines forming a golden cross upward, bullish momentum persists, no signs of weakening.
4. Volume: Moderate increase intraday, linked with large market capital inflows, limited selling pressure at high levels, support absorption steady.
5. Bollinger Bands: Price running close to the upper band, channel widening, clear upward oscillation pattern.
